Bonus Mathematics

Let’s break down the typical welcome bonus at Lucky Nugget casino. Suppose the offer is a 100% match up to €200 (actual offers may vary – always check the latest terms). You deposit €100, receiving an extra €100 bonus, giving you a total of €200 to play.

Important: The wagering requirement is usually 40x the deposit plus bonus. So the total you must wager is (€100 deposit + €100 bonus) × 40 = €8,000.

Now factor in the game’s return‑to‑player (RTP). If you play a slot with 96% RTP, the house edge is 4%. Over €8,000 in wagers, your expected loss is €8,000 × 0.04 = €320. Since your bonus is only €100, the expected value (EV) of the bonus is:

EV = Bonus – Expected loss = €100 – €320 = –€220.

This negative EV means the bonus is unfavorable on average. To improve your odds, choose games with higher RTP (e.g., 98% slots reduce loss to €8,000 × 0.02 = €160, giving EV = –€60). Always read the terms for game weightings and maximum bet limits.

Is It Safe?

Lucky Nugget casino operates under a Curacao eGaming license, which provides a basic level of oversight. The site uses SSL encryption to protect your data. However, because it is not licensed by stricter regulators like the MGA or UKGC, you should:

  • Verify the license seal (often at the footer of the homepage).
  • Enable two‑factor authentication (2FA) if available.
  • Keep records of all transactions and communications.
  • Remember that winnings from Curacao‑licensed sites may not be tax‑free in your country – consult local laws.
